Cubo is a fast-paced dice rolling game played in six rounds with all players rolling their dice simultaneously. The colors and pallet of Cubo are inspired by the Holi Festival of Colors, Happiness and Peace, a festival that celebrates a wonderful message and ties in nicely with the social and friendly event of boardgaming. Cubo has a real-time mechanism that is brought forth not with a timer, but rather by a limited resource: the four dice in the center of the table. Gain as many points as possible with your nine dice by composing straights and trips.

Frequently Asked Questions

Cubo supports 2 to 4 players.
A typical game of Cubo takes about 20 minutes.
Cubo has a complexity rating of 1.58/5.00 on BoardGameGeek, placing it in the 'Light' category. It is very accessible and great for new gamers.
The recommended minimum age for Cubo is 8+. Younger children may enjoy it with guidance from experienced players.
Cubo has a rating of 5.64/10 on BoardGameGeek, based on 332 ratings. It is ranked #21950 overall.
Cubo was designed by Johannes Berger, Julien Gupta. It was published in 2014.
